Rinderpest, one of the great historic plagues, was introduced with devastating effect into Africa towards the end of the 19th century. Its causative agent, rinderpest virus, a morbillivirus very closely related to human measles virus, decimates the cattle population. This title offers the history of Rinderpest, vaccines and vaccination.

The technology of crystal growth has advanced enormously. Among these advances, the development and refinement of Molecular Beam Epitaxy (MBE) has been among the most important. This title provides comprehensive treatment of the basic materials and surface science principles that apply to molecular beam epitaxy.
